开源项目已成为推动技术进步的重要力量。Java山寨QQ代码作为一款开源项目,不仅为广大开发者提供了学习交流的平台,还激发了无数创业者的灵感。本文将深入剖析Java山寨QQ代码,探讨其背后的技术魅力与创业启示。
一、Java山寨QQ代码的技术魅力
1. 技术架构
Java山寨QQ代码采用MVC(Model-View-Controller)模式,将业务逻辑、数据模型和用户界面分离,提高了代码的可维护性和扩展性。它采用了Spring框架、MyBatis持久层框架等技术,实现了分层设计和解耦,降低了系统复杂度。
2. 消息传递机制
Java山寨QQ代码采用WebSocket技术实现实时消息传递,支持点对点、群聊等功能。WebSocket技术具有低延迟、高吞吐量等特点,为用户提供流畅的聊天体验。
3. 安全性
Java山寨QQ代码注重安全性,采用HTTPS协议加密数据传输,防止数据泄露。它还实现了用户认证、权限控制等功能,确保系统安全稳定运行。
4. 可扩展性
Java山寨QQ代码具有良好的可扩展性,开发者可以根据实际需求添加新功能、优化性能。例如,通过引入Redis缓存、分布式数据库等技术,可以提高系统并发处理能力。
二、Java山寨QQ代码的创业启示
1. 开源精神
Java山寨QQ代码的成功离不开开源精神的推动。开源项目让开发者共享技术成果,降低了创业门槛,为创业者提供了丰富的技术资源。创业者应积极拥抱开源,发挥自身优势,为技术创新贡献力量。
2. 技术驱动
Java山寨QQ代码的技术实力是其成功的关键。创业者应注重技术研发,不断提升产品竞争力。要关注行业动态,紧跟技术发展趋势,确保产品始终处于行业前沿。
3. 团队协作
Java山寨QQ代码的成功离不开团队成员的共同努力。创业者要注重团队建设,发挥团队协作优势,共同攻克技术难题。要关注团队成员的个人成长,激发团队活力。
4. 市场定位
Java山寨QQ代码在市场定位上准确,满足了用户对即时通讯工具的需求。创业者要深入分析市场需求,找准产品定位,确保产品具有市场竞争力。
Java山寨QQ代码作为一款开源项目,以其精湛的技术和丰富的功能,为开发者提供了宝贵的经验。它所蕴含的技术魅力和创业启示,值得我们深入挖掘。在未来的创业道路上,让我们共同学习、借鉴,为技术创新和产业发展贡献力量。